Charging Speed Capabilities

While evaluating Level 2 EV chargers for your Tesla Model 3, consider the charging speed capabilities that can greatly impact your daily convenience. Level 2 chargers can deliver up to 44 miles of range per hour, notably reducing your charging time compared to Level 1 options. With output power typically ranging from 32A to 48A, you can achieve a maximum charging power of 11.5 kW. Look for chargers with adjustable amperage settings, allowing you to customize charging speeds based on your home’s electrical infrastructure. Many Level 2 chargers also let you schedule charging sessions during off-peak hours, helping you save on electricity costs. Fast charging capabilities make overnight recharging practical, ensuring your Tesla Model 3 is ready for your daily adventures.

Installation Requirements

Before you plunge into selecting a Level 2 EV charger for your Tesla Model 3, it’s essential to understand the installation requirements that will guarantee peak performance. You’ll need a licensed electrician to install the charger on a dedicated circuit with at least a 60A rating. Most Level 2 chargers operate at 240 volts and can deliver up to 48 amps, so make sure your electrical infrastructure can handle this output. Whether you install it indoors or outdoors, proper weatherproofing is vital for outdoor setups. Additionally, consider the charger’s variable amperage settings—like 48A, 40A, or 32A—to match your existing power supply. Finally, comply with local electrical codes and obtain necessary permits to guarantee safety and legality.

Safety Certifications and Ratings

When selecting a Level 2 EV charger for your Tesla Model 3, safety certifications and ratings are crucial factors to take into account. Look for chargers with UL, ETL, or FCC certifications, as these indicate they’ve passed rigorous safety tests. An IP66 rating is essential, ensuring the charger is protected against dust and powerful water jets, making it suitable for both indoor and outdoor use. Additionally, features like overcurrent, overheating, and surge protection help guard your vehicle during charging. Opt for weatherproof enclosures rated NEMA 4 or higher for durability against environmental factors. Not only do these safety standards enhance your protection, but they can also be necessary for qualifying for local incentives or rebates.
